Linux如何查看文件夹大小

1. 概述

在Linux系统中,我们经常需要查看文件夹的大小,以便了解磁盘空间的使用情况。本文将介绍几种常用的命令和工具,用于查看文件夹的大小。

2. 使用du命令

2.1 查看当前文件夹大小

du命令用于估算文件或目录的磁盘使用空间。如果不指定文件夹路径,默认会计算当前目录下所有文件夹的大小。

du -sh

-s参数用于汇总文件夹的大小,-h参数以更易读的方式显示文件夹大小。

2.2 查看指定文件夹大小

如果要查看特定文件夹的大小,可以在du命令后面加上文件夹路径。

du -sh /path/to/folder

其中/path/to/folder是待查看文件夹的路径。

2.3 查看文件夹下每个子目录的大小

如果需要了解文件夹下每个子目录的大小,可以使用下面的命令:

du -h --max-depth=1 /path/to/folder

该命令将会显示指定文件夹下每个子目录的大小,--max-depth=1参数用于控制显示的层级深度。

3. 使用ncdu命令

3.1 安装ncdu

ncdu是一个基于ncurses的磁盘使用分析工具,可以以交互式界面的形式快速查看文件夹的大小。

sudo apt-get install ncdu

在Ubuntu和Debian系统上,可以使用上面的命令进行安装。其他Linux发行版的安装方法可能会有所不同。

3.2 使用ncdu查看文件夹大小

安装完ncdu后,使用下面的命令来查看文件夹的大小:

ncdu /path/to/folder

ncdu会递归地计算指定文件夹下所有文件和子文件夹的大小,并以交互式界面的方式展示。

注意:由于ncdu使用交互式界面,可能需要在终端窗口中使用功能键来进行操作。

4. 使用graphical disk usage analyzer工具

4.1 安装gdmap

如果你使用的是图形化界面,可以考虑安装gdmap工具来查看文件夹的大小。

sudo apt-get install gdmap

gdmap可以以图形的形式展示磁盘空间的使用情况,方便查看文件夹的大小。

4.2 使用gdmap查看文件夹大小

安装完gdmap后,打开终端并执行下面的命令启动gdmap:

gdmap

gdmap会打开一个图形界面,显示当前系统的磁盘使用情况。你可以浏览文件夹层级,并通过颜色区分不同大小的文件和文件夹。

5. 总结

通过du命令、ncdu命令和gdmap工具,我们可以方便地查看Linux系统中文件夹的大小。du命令是最基本的命令行工具,ncdu命令提供了交互式界面,gdmap工具则适用于图形化界面的用户。根据使用场景的不同,选择合适的工具来查看文件夹大小。

操作系统标签